The Thriller singer passed away from acute Propofol intoxication,
and a golden casket thought to contain his body was installed in a crypt in
California. However, it has now been claimed he was secretly cremated – with
reports stating his kids had his remains encased in jewellery shaped like
broken hearts. ‘The ashes are now in necklaces like the one that Paris wore to
Michael’s memorial service and wrapped around his wrist as he lay in his open
coffin,’ a source claimed. ‘She and her brothers rarely wear the necklaces in
public.
Michael Jackson died in 2009, leaving behind children Paris, Prince
Michael and Blanket – who now goes by Bigi. And it has been claimed the
youngsters wear sentimental jewellery containing his ashes. They keep them in
locked boxes at home, as they’re afraid of losing the last remains of their father.’
Radar Online claims Michael’s mum, Katherine, secretly had his body cremated in
a bid to deter people from trying to rob his grave.
The reports come after documentary Leaving Neverland aired earlier this year,
exploring claims the singer sexually abused Wade Robson and James Safechuck
when they were children. A source previously added to the publication:
‘Everyone thinks Michael is buried at Forest Lawn, but he’s not. ‘The family
has kept the secret for safety reasons and to fulfil Michael’s wishes. But
Katherine has privately revealed the truth to trusted friends… ‘Katherine was
paranoid and scared someone would steal his body.’ They also suggested his
ashes were scattered at his Neverland home.
